How it is preformed
On the day of Heirflamme, the blade Dynseal is placed on a megalithic circle on The Watcher's Height, a hill just outside the city of Endhiem. If done at the appointed hour, the jewel in the pommel of the blade will split the light of dawn into a prismatic spray of light, filling the circle.
What it does
One thing this does is re-distribute ley power, moving it with Dynseal from the Temple of Aethos to the empty ley resevoir under The Watcher's Height.
The most visible effect is the area of multicolored radience. During the minute and a half at which this exists, those who enter the illuminated area will be rendered unable to move, and the entirity of all possible futures and (once) possible pasts will be presented to them, an infinite amount of information rushed by and through them in an miniscule unit of time.
Aftereffects
The ones who undertake this are usually prospective monarchs or those who desire higher status in society. It is believed that those who can avoid having their mind destroyed in the shocking instant of limitless clarity become intensly wise, and may even retain some memory of possible futures.
The majority are reduced to drooling husks.
